首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 156 毫秒
1.
逻辑函数求补是大变量逻辑优化的算法基础.采用二叉树结构,用C语言实现了大变量逻辑函数求补递归算法.详述了求补二叉树的结构和形成过程,以及在求补二叉树上补集的收集方法.  相似文献   

2.
刘维富 《微机发展》2002,12(5):18-21
逻辑函数数求补是大变量逻辑优化的算法基础,采用二叉树结构,用C语言实现了大变量逻辑函数求补递归算法。详述了求补二叉树的结构和形成过程,以及在求补二叉树上补集的收集方法。  相似文献   

3.
基于链式结构XML文档的生成方法   总被引:4,自引:0,他引:4  
提出了一种基于链式结构的XML文档生成方法,设计了一个利用Java中的stream tokenizer类实现HTML文档解析的算法,将解析得到的元素内容及文本内容生成的结点插入到相应的位置上,同步生成DOM解析树,对DOM解析树进行遍历,将遍历得到的信息以二叉链表的形式存储,采用改进的先根遍历算法对该二叉链表遍历,提取相应的信息构建DTD,完成整个转换生成的过程。  相似文献   

4.
查峰 《计算机工程》2009,35(4):48-50
将树形数据结构用于最小化DOM模型XML编解码器的开发。在解析XML文本时,基于Expat解释器将XML字符串构造成树状结构;编码时构造DOM树结构,采用非递归深度优先法遍历树,将其串行化成XML串。本编解码器解决了国际化语言关键问题,是一个通用、高效的工业级XML应用支撑模块。  相似文献   

5.
卢骏  关治洪  王华 《机器人》2006,28(3):264-268
利用流函数解决单个移动机器人的避障问题,并提出了基于流函数和单一连接规则的、采用虚拟leader和二叉树结构的多移动机器人swarming控制模型.基于单一连接规则的二叉树结构使得整个机器人群的控制更简单,更灵活;而虚拟leader的引入,使机器人群在避障过程中不会发生分离,并能够很好地解决类似于机器人掉队的问题,提高了系统的稳定性,增强了系统的应变能力.仿真结果验证了该模型的有效性.  相似文献   

6.
基于XML的Web数据库技术   总被引:3,自引:0,他引:3  
探讨了两种将关系数据转换的XML文档的语言描述及其实现技术,一种是利用RXL(Relational to XML Transformation Language)语言来定义一个关系数据库的XML视图,该XML视图的虚的,应用再利用XML查询语言XML-QL在虚的视图上构造一个查询,抽取XML视图中的数据片断并对抽取的部分进行 物化,实现将关系数据转换为XML文档。另一种是利用并扩展SQL的功能来描述这种转换,嵌套的SQL表达式被利用来描述嵌套,扩展的SQL函数被利用来描述XML元素构造,实现将关系数据构造成XML文档。  相似文献   

7.
以XML文档发布关系数据   总被引:2,自引:0,他引:2  
本文对以XML文档发布关系数据的新技术进行了综述,主要分析了两种发布关系数据到XML文档的语言描述及其实现技术,以及它们的优缺点,一种是利用并扩展SQL的功能来描述这种转换,嵌套的SQL表达式被利用来描述嵌套,扩展的SQL标量及聚集函数被利用来描述XML元素构造,实现将关系数据转换为XML文档,另一种是利用RXL(Relational to XML Transformation Language)语言来定义一个关系数据库的XML视图,该XML视图是虚的,其它应用可再利用XML查询语言XML-QL在虚拟的视图上构造一个查询,抽取XML视图中的数据片断并对抽取的部分进行物化,实现将关系数据转换为XML文档。  相似文献   

8.
针对互联网产生的异构数据集成问题,首先提出基于云计算环境下采用中间件方法,利用可扩展标记语言(eXtensibleMarkupLanguage,XML)为交换数据介质,实现异构数据的无障碍获取,特别是对于非结构型数据,采用全文检索方法实现对非结构数据的转换;其次构建异构数据集成的结构模型,并分析模型中各组件的功能;最后研究了实现模型的关键技术,解决了异构数据到XML文档的转换和生成问题,以及对转换后的XML文档的解析问题,采用Java编程语言使用XML文档作为数据交换介质,从而实现异构数据的集成。  相似文献   

9.
代理关键字被普遍应用于数据仓库的构建。在XML Schema映射为数据仓库结构的情况下,该文提出一种引入代理关键字的处理方法,利用Java工具包,将XML Schema转换成XOM树结构,在转换成关系模式时加入代理关键字,实现了XML文档与数据仓库间的直接转换。实验结果证明了该算法的有效性。  相似文献   

10.
现阶段,XML文档的查询是根据路径表达来导航的,针对XML查询语言而言,对于其数据库查询优化的关键是XML路径表达式.本文作者通过对现有的路径表达式查询中几种优化技术的分析研究,提出了在XML语言查询中的一些重要问题,并根据其主要的技术特点提出了自己的观点,旨在提高对XML路径表达式查询技术的优化.  相似文献   

11.
数学表达式、栈的操作、二又树的遍历,这几个概念在数据结构的教材中是不可缺少的。数学表达式求值是程序设计语言编译中的一个最基本问题,也是栈应用的一个典型例子,用它来研制出各种类型的电子计算器(前缀计算器、中缀计算器(常见的计算器)、后缀计算器)。在数据结构中没有解决表达式与二又树之间的相互转换关系,也就是说不能由一种表达式迅速地得到另外的两种表达式,也就难于解决其他两种计算器的研制过程。本文旨在研究表达式与二叉树间的相互转换关系,便于由一种表达式(或表达式树)迅速求出其他的表达式,再通过栈的应用(操作)研制出三种不同的计算器(栈的应用在数据结构的教材中都有,在此文中不予介绍)。  相似文献   

12.
针对二叉树的链式存储结构,分析了二叉树的各种遍历算法,探讨了递归算法的递推消除问题,提出了一种改进的非递归遍历算法并用C语言予以实现。  相似文献   

13.
编码技术是可扩展标记语言(XML)查询处理的基础,传统编码技术利用自然数进行编码,很难支持XML动态更新。提出了更新支持的编码方法——ITBI,该方法将整数映射到完全二叉树,利用二叉树的中序遍历定义整数新的序关系,通过新的序关系重排自然数序列将静态编码转化为动态编码。同时,基于ITBI前驱、后继、距离等定义,设计了最短位长动态编码分配算法,有效控制更新过程中编码位长的增加。最后通过实验验证了编码的有效性。  相似文献   

14.
XML文档数据编码模式是XML文档查询处理的基础, 好的文档编码模式有利于提高文档的查询效率. 为了解决XML数据查询效率低、支持动态更新等问题. 本文在二叉树遍历的编码基础上, 引入二叉树的三叉链表存储结构对XML文档结点进行编码. 该编码利用自然数作为编码序号, 因此编码长度较短; 引入结点双亲指针, 方便结点之间结构关系的判定, 结点采用三叉树链式存储, 方便文档的更新操作.  相似文献   

15.
研究了针对区间数样本的支持向量机分类问题。定义了区间数样本与超立方体之间的映射关系,研究了基于区间数样本的超立方体表示框架;提出了基于二叉树完整遍历的满足样本约束的超平面顶点采样方法,建立了通过分类目标函数转换的分类学习模型。实验仿真结果表明了该方法的可行性与有效性。  相似文献   

16.
基于遍历序列的唯一确定树或二叉树的方法   总被引:5,自引:0,他引:5  
基于遍历序列的唯一确定树或二叉树的方法既体现了树或二叉村的遍历序列的部分性质,又是建立树或二叉村的存储结构的主要依据,本文首先介绍了由一棵二叉树的某两种遍历序列或某种遍历序列和结点的某种信息可以唯一确定该二叉树的各种可能方法,然后分别针对树、严格二叉树与雨季叉排序树加以介绍,本文比较全面的介绍了基于遍历离列的唯一确定树或二叉树的方法,进一步完善了树或二叉树的遍历序列的性质。  相似文献   

17.
目前可编程仪器标准命令(SCPI)依然被广泛使用,因此设计一个高效通用的SCPI命令解释器很重要。常用的SCPI命令解释器多以C语言开发,采用链式二叉树等存储结构,多有如解析效率低、通用性差、不识别等效命令等缺点。因此提出一种基于Python语言的设计。相比于常用的链式二叉树或顺序存储等结构,本设计提出一种基于Python字典结构的新型存储结构,减少了解析时的查询次数,提高了解析效率。而针对常用SCPI命令解释器通用性差的缺点,本设计提出以XML文档描述SCPI命令树,在启动时动态加载进内存的方式提高了解释器的通用性。同时,由于Python跨平台的特性,所设计的SCPI命令解释器也拥有良好的跨平台特性,适于在各平台下工作。  相似文献   

18.
通过对同一棵二叉树的前序遍历、中序遍历、后序遍历及层次遍历得到四个不同序列的分析,概括出二叉树的前序遍历、中序遍历、后序遍历及层次遍历序列间的关系,确定对应的二叉树。  相似文献   

19.
XML文档对象模型研究与应用   总被引:7,自引:0,他引:7  
从XML文档的基本结构出发,详细论述了DOM树、节点树结构特征及DOM的基本接口。结合产品定单实例实现XML文档结构树的动态创建、遍历,并通过XML DOM接口实现对文档结构树的操作等核心应用。  相似文献   

20.
构造二叉树的两个改进算法   总被引:2,自引:0,他引:2  
在数据结构中,已知一棵二叉树的先序序列和中序序列,可唯一确定此二叉树.本文在分析建立二叉树经典算法的时间复杂度的基础上,给出了两个改进算法:①利用哈希函数,使得改进后的算法在最差情况下,时间复杂度由O(n2)降为O(n);②利用栈和控制输入的结点序列构造二叉树,时间复杂度也由O(n2)降为O(n).  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号